Mercedes Formula 1 star George Russell has teased a new partnership ahead of the 2025 season following Lewis Hamilton 's exit ...
South Africa is making significant progress in its journey to host a Formula 1 Grand Prix by 2026, by inviting potential host ...
All WeatherTech SportsCar Championship GTD Pro and GTD cars are competing with torque sensors attached to their rear axles ...
The 2024 Qatar Grand Prix marked 20 years exactly to the day when Hamilton drove an F1 car for the first time. The Brit was ...